PROVIDENCE, R.I. - The Eastern Connecticut State University baseball team climbed the ladder in both national polls this week, reaching No. 2 in the D3baseball.com Poll and No. 8 in the Collegiate Baseball Newspaper Division III Poll. UMass Boston continues to receive votes in both polls.
The Warriors record stands at 16-2 following yesterday’s 10-inning 10-5 win at Trinity (Conn.). Last week, Eastern posted a 13-1 non-conference win over Wheaton (Mass.) before sweeping a Little East Conference (LEC) doubleheader against Plymouth State by scores of 11-5 and 14-1.
UMass Boston improved 14-4 after defeating Endicott 5-3 Tuesday. Last week saw the Beacons drop non-conference decisions at Roger Williams (9-7) and Western New England (17-11) before sweeping a league twin bill against Castleton, taking the opener 7-4 and the nightcap 12-2.
The Warriors are remaining schedule this week includes a non-conference game at Johnson & Wales Thursday before taking on UMass Dartmouth in a LEC doubleheader Saturday. UMass Boston is next scheduled to host Roger Williams Thursday and a non-conference twin bill against Suffolk Saturday.
